測繪程序設計實驗指導書_第1頁
測繪程序設計實驗指導書_第2頁
測繪程序設計實驗指導書_第3頁
測繪程序設計實驗指導書_第4頁
測繪程序設計實驗指導書_第5頁
已閱讀5頁,還剩20頁未讀 繼續(xù)免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

1、測繪程序設計上機實驗指導書華北科技學院測繪工程系2014年1月實驗一:線性方程組解算一、實驗目的與要求初步掌握線性方程組的算法;初步掌握線線性方程組在計算機上實現(xiàn)方法。二、實驗安排實驗共需用2學時。實驗每個小組1人,用VB等語言在計算機上完成程序代碼的編寫,并調試通過,然后用算例印證程序的正確性。三、實驗步驟及要點在課余時間,提前準備線性方程組解算程序代碼;上機時寫入代碼,并調試運行;用算例進行印證。四、實驗指導具體算法參見講義。利用高斯消去法,根據(jù)算法,寫出程序代碼。五、思考題如何利用其他解法完成計算機數(shù)據(jù)處理。實驗二:矩陣解算與角度運算一、實驗目的與要求初步掌握矩陣的加減乘除及矩陣的轉置、

2、求逆等基本運算在計算機上的實現(xiàn)方法;掌握度分秒轉換在計算機上實現(xiàn)的方法。二、實驗安排本實驗需要2學時。實驗每個小組1人,用VB語言在計算機上完成程序代碼的編寫,并調試通過,然后用算例印證程序的正確性。三、實驗步驟及要點1在課下寫出程序代碼,重點是 矩陣求逆和度分秒轉換;2上課時在計算機上寫入程序代碼,調試運行,通過后用算例進行測試。四、實驗指導1.矩陣解法參見教材,下面給出測試數(shù)據(jù)。 2. 角度互化問題在計算機數(shù)據(jù)處理中經常遇到,計算機要求三角函數(shù)中的角度必須是弧度制,這樣引用計算機中的三角函數(shù)進行計算時,結果才是正確的,反過來,求出的角度值也是一弧度為單位的,所以還需把弧度轉換為度分秒的形式

3、。 算例:32°29'30''= 弧度 ,0.3212= 度 分 秒五、思考題在什么情況下需要使用度分秒轉化;在什么情況下利用矩陣解算程序。實驗三:高斯投影正反算及換帶計算一、實驗目的和要求初步掌握控制測量數(shù)據(jù)處理過程中的數(shù)據(jù)結構類型;初步學會控制測量常用軟件設計方法、過程、程序代碼編寫方法及程序調試過程。二、實驗安排本實驗需要4學時。實驗每個小組1人,用VB語言在計算機上完成程序代碼的編寫,并調試通過,然后用實際算例印證程序的正確性。三、實驗步驟及要點課余時間完成預先布置的控制測量數(shù)據(jù)處理問題,完成程序代碼的紙上編寫和設計工作;(上級題目可以根據(jù)自己的情況,

4、任意選做一個即可)在計算機上寫入程序代碼,進行調試; 用預先準備好的算例進行印證,要求每人至少準備2組典型算例,并打印測試結果,附在實驗報告中。四、實驗指導1高斯投影坐標換帶程序設計指導1)坐標正算公式如下:(見大地測量學基礎專業(yè)課本)2)坐標反算公式2、坐標鄰帶及換帶計算1)首先利用x,y轉換到B,2)計算其中央子午線,計算鄰帶中央子午線3)再由B,換算到x,y五、思考題1思考如何編寫高程控制網嚴密平差程序。2如何編寫高程測量概算程序。實驗四:曲線放樣程序設計一、實驗目的和要求初步掌握工程測量中常用軟件設計方法和技巧。二、實驗安排本實驗需要4學時。實驗每個小組1人,用VB語言在計算機上完成程

5、序代碼的編寫,并調試通過,然后用實際算例印證程序的正確性。三、實驗步驟及要點課余時間完成預先布置的控制測量數(shù)據(jù)處理問題,完成程序代碼的紙上編寫和設計工作;在計算機上寫入程序代碼,進行調試;用預先準備好的算例進行印證,要求每人至少準備12組典型算例,并打印測試結果,附在實驗報告中。四、實驗指導、曲線放樣程序設計(也可以利用工程測量課本的例題驗證)算例:圓曲線,中線交點JD1的里程樁為 k1500,其偏角右60°00,圓曲線設計半徑R60m加密樁間距=10m 。主要計算公式:主點定位元素的計算公式:×=34.6410= 62.8318m=R(sec)=9.2820m q=2T-

6、L=6.4502m 主點里程參數(shù)計算公式: ZY =JD -T=K1+465.359 YZ =ZY +L=K1+528.1908 QZ =YZ =K1+496.7749 檢核 K1+496.7749+D/2=K1+500 偏角法計算公式 = =2Rsin要求:1)、利用VB語言自動實現(xiàn)主點要素計算2)、通過程序設計,實現(xiàn)圓曲線的細部點測設計算,計算偏角及距離3)、盡量可以將測設元素保存在文檔中。五、思考題如果編寫變形觀測程序時,請思考數(shù)據(jù)處理與圖形繪制為一體的程序設計實現(xiàn)方法。實驗五:GPS衛(wèi)星位置計算程序設計一、實驗目的和要求初步掌握GPS數(shù)據(jù)處理軟件中的數(shù)據(jù)結構格式;初步掌握GPS平差軟件

7、的編寫方法和思路;實現(xiàn)GPS 衛(wèi)星位置計算程序設計二、實驗安排本實驗需要2學時。實驗每個小組1人,用VB語言在計算機上完成程序代碼的編寫,并調試通過,然后用實際算例印證程序的正確性。三、實驗步驟及要點課余時間完成預先布置的控制測量數(shù)據(jù)處理問題,完成程序代碼的紙上編寫和設計工作;在計算機上寫入程序代碼,進行調試;用預先準備好的算例進行印證,要求每人至少準備12組典型算例,并打印測試結果,附在實驗報告中。四、實驗指導各種GPS數(shù)據(jù)格式參見教材;計算步驟如下:1).平均角速度 (mean angular speed):Dn由廣播星歷獲得, GM=3.986005e+142).規(guī)化時刻(normal

8、time):t0已知(由廣播星歷獲得),t為GPS周秒3).平近點角(mean anomaly): M0已知(由廣播星歷獲得)4).偏近點角(eccentric anomaly):迭代求解:初始值取E=M,以弧度為單位5).真近點角(true anomaly):6).升交距角(argument of ascending node):w近地點角距(argument of perigee)7). 軌道向徑(Orbital radius):8). 擾動改正(Perturbed correction): 升交角距(Argument of ascending node) 軌道向徑(Orbital rad

9、ius) 軌道頃角(Orbital inclination) 是升交角距 (the argument of ascending node)9). 改正后升交角距、軌道向徑、軌道傾角改正后升交角距(Corrected argument of ascending nod)改正后的軌道向徑(Corrected orbital radius)改正后的軌道傾角(Corrected orbital inclination) 10).衛(wèi)星在升交點軌道直角坐標系中的坐標:如下圖所示 11. 升交點經度(Longitude of ascending node):如下圖所示12. 在地固坐標系中的衛(wèi)星位置(Exp

10、ressed in spheric coordinate system)3算例可以利用教材GPS衛(wèi)星定位原理及應用)五、思考題如何編寫實用的GPS后處理軟件。如何從GPS星歷數(shù)據(jù)文件中提取數(shù)據(jù)。實驗六:Excel在測繪工程中的應用一、實驗目的和要求初步了解電子表格在測繪中的應用方法。二、實驗安排本實驗需要2學時。實驗每個小組1人,用Excel在計算機上繪制電子表格,利用此表格實現(xiàn)測量外業(yè)記錄和數(shù)據(jù)處理,然后用實際算例印證其可行性。三、實驗步驟及要求1.用VBA完成前方交會自定義函數(shù);用Excel繪制電子表格,寫入數(shù)據(jù),用函數(shù)完成計算,輸出計算結果,打印成果表。2.準備一個算例,如導線測量內業(yè)計

11、算,表7-11 鋼尺量距圖根附合導線坐標計算表點號°觀測角(°)角度改正數(shù)改正后的角(°)坐標方位角(°)距離(m)x(m)y(m)x(m)y(m)x(m)y(m)B237.99167A991099.01670.0016799.018333157.01000225.853-207.91488.212-207.86988.1662507.6931215.63211674536167.76000.00167167.761667144.77167139.032-113.57080.199-113.54280.1712299.8241303.7982123112

12、4123.19000.00167123.19166787.96333172.5716.133172.4626.168172.4272186.2821383.96931892036189.34330.00167189.34500097.30833100.074-12.73099.261-12.71099.2412192.4501556.39641795918179.98830.00167179.99000097.29833102.485-13.0193101.6547-12.999101.6342179.7401655.637C1292724129.45670.00167129.45833346

13、.756672166.7411757.271D46.756672166.7411757.271和888.755000.010759.3067740.015-341.100541.788-340.952541.639輔助計算46.74667-340.952541.639 -0.1480.149-0.010000.210-361471/3521<1/2000注:加粗數(shù)據(jù)為觀測值,加粗及有下劃線的數(shù)據(jù)為已知數(shù)據(jù),加粗斜體數(shù)據(jù)為檢核數(shù)據(jù),其余數(shù)據(jù)為公式計算結果。或準備一個經緯儀導線計算算例,閉合或附合導線均可,數(shù)據(jù)自備。四、實驗指導前方交會算例、利用VBA書寫自定義函數(shù),實現(xiàn)下列算例的前方交會。

14、弧度正切Xa659.232Ya355.537 a691131.207tana2.630328724Xb406.593Yb654.051ß5942391.042tanß1.712037939Xa-Xb252.639Ya-Yb-298.514tana.tanß4.503222566tana.tanß4.342366663Xa.tana1733.9969Ya.tana935.1792Xb.tanß696.1026Yb.tanß1119.7601(Yb-Ya).tana.tanß1344.275(Xa-Xb).tana.tan

15、23;1137.6896Xp869.198Yp735.228五、思考題更為復雜的計算問題如何用Excel實現(xiàn)。實驗七:Matlab在測繪工程中的應用一、實驗目的和要求初步掌握用Mat lab進行數(shù)據(jù)處理的方法和過程;初步掌握Mat lab軟件設計方法。二、實驗安排本實驗需要24學時。實驗每個小組1人,用Mat lab在計算機上實現(xiàn)各種測量數(shù)據(jù)處理問題,學會開發(fā)簡單的測繪程序。三、實驗步驟及要點準備算例;用Matlab在計算機上實現(xiàn)數(shù)據(jù)處理;開發(fā)簡單的測繪程序,調試運行,用實例印證。4.用Math lab完成實驗一中的方程組結算工作。四、實驗指導MATLAB的主要線性代數(shù)運算 實現(xiàn)下列數(shù)據(jù)擬合生

16、成三維圖:3075279.946 549271.599 574.773 3075150.754 549139.377 595.410 3075070.705 549055.602 610.618 3074887.835 548917.800 610.983 3074801.102 548880.364 607.822 3074754.051 548832.471 605.039 3074692.878 548780.212 602.844 3074690.912 548831.712 603.376 3074684.805 548829.275 603.366 3074689.631 5488

17、35.979 603.326 3074696.181 548832.341 603.353 3074691.918 548826.179 603.409 3074486.296 548809.029 609.365 3074588.997 548687.160 600.680 3074067.406 548505.089 607.992 3073885.686 548587.906 606.496 3074830.908 548979.484 615.260 3074457.838 548776.570 607.620 3074360.858 548718.493 607.899 307414

18、6.854 548563.536 607.178 3074036.300 548590.674 610.096 3073900.435 549244.547 631.647 3073836.378 549166.776 625.977 3073762.715 549156.903 627.644 3074001.565 549169.620 635.232 3073865.836 549100.296 621.255 3073798.584 549041.929 614.642 3074983.730 549008.795 612.325 3074056.613 549033.430 642.

19、428 3073957.872 549035.190 622.750 3073897.019 549018.483 615.824 3073791.562 548884.468 621.010 3074066.964 548972.607 643.930 3073942.813 548928.575 630.607 3073876.484 548881.885 618.173 3073752.933 548797.413 631.880 3074116.459 548947.873 648.041 3074002.874 548848.641 641.536 3073956.043 54876

20、4.928 643.738 3073848.451 548696.940 612.527 3074454.483 549010.639 627.084 3074350.131 548931.000 631.587 3074183.453 548837.318 634.586 3074099.948 548737.487 636.098 3074028.880 548711.013 655.200 3073939.505 548645.890 624.071 3073872.268 548588.706 606.181 3074455.760 548936.859 611.542 3074254

21、.368 548761.333 620.431 3074207.345 548727.351 620.628 3074029.821 548626.142 633.022 3074839.730 549123.030 632.035 3074671.529 548980.752 631.089 3074592.151 548916.165 623.454 3074231.503 548648.211 610.788 3074179.302 548517.185 610.418 3075195.722 549258.294 583.571 3074945.682 549049.367 621.612 3074852.771 549009.695 622.351 3074746.172 548941.346 621.982 3074718.715 548910.068 612.770 3074500.311 548701.989 608.797 3074614.315 548712.895 599.087 3074247.465 548572.141 610.298 3074143.417 548807.114 633.895 3074615.600 548757.192 601.55

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論